Lubrication system for a gate valve

The present invention provides method for providing lubrication to a gate sealing element located between first and second housing sections of a gate valve having a moveable gate, wherein the gate is moved by energizing an actuator. The method includes the steps of providing a lubricant for lubricating the gate sealing element, providing a lubricant passageway for supplying the lubricant to the gate sealing element, providing a moveable plunger element for moving the lubricant from the cartridge to the gate sealing element via the lubricant passageway, and moving the gate to move the plunger element to cause the lubricant to move from the cartridge to the gate sealing element.

Dispenser apparatus and method

A dispenser and procedure for disinfecting and cleaning air conditioner condensation drainage lines and other condensation drainage lines. The dispenser can be installed at any convenient location on any floor of a home or other building, regardless of whether the location is below, above, or at the same elevation as the inlet of the condensation drainage line. The dispenser includes a liquid pump for delivering an amount of treatment fluid into a treatment delivery line and an air pump for pushing the dose of treatment fluid through the treatment delivery line and into the condensation drainage line.

Hydraulic fracturing plan and execution of same

A hydraulic fracturing plan executable by a hydraulic fracturing system to hydraulically fracture at least first and second wells. In one or more embodiments, executing the hydraulic fracturing plan includes opening a first valve while hydraulic fracturing fluid is communicated to the second well via a second valve and a manifold, the first valve being associated with both the first well and the manifold, and the second valve being associated with both the second well and the manifold. In one or more embodiments, executing the hydraulic fracturing plan further includes closing the second valve, wherein the second valve is closed after opening the first valve, and while hydraulic fracturing fluid is communicated to the first well via the first valve and the manifold.

Tool for unseizing and lubricating well valves, and method of unseizing said valves

A tool for unseizing and/or lubricating a valve having a protruding valve stem on an exterior periphery. The tool possesses a hollow tubular member, having at one end thereof an open, hollow, cylindrical flexible member adapted to be placed over and contain therewithin a portion of the valve stem. A circumferential tightening member, encircling one end of the flexible member, is provided, to permit the flexible member to sealingly engage the valve stem about the outer periphery thereof when the flexible member is placed over the valve stem. The tool further possesses a fluid inlet port, situated along a length of the tubular member, in fluid communication with an interior of the tubular member, and a pressurized fluid inlet port likewise in fluid communication with the interior of the tool.

Aseptic valve assembly, system for conducting a product, and method for operating a system

A valve assembly comprises a housing, a chamber having a first product opening, a second product opening, a first closable secondary opening that can be connected to a steam line, and a second closable secondary opening. The assembly also includes a first closing element by which the first product opening can be closed, a second closing element by which the second product opening can be closed, and an outlet associated with the second secondary opening. A switching valve is arranged between the second secondary opening and the outlet such that a fluid connection between the outlet and the second secondary opening can be switched to a fluid connection between the outlet and an inlet provided on the switching valve. The inlet can be connected to a steam line, while simultaneously closing the second secondary opening. A system comprising the valve assembly and a method for operating the system are described.

Valve assembly, vacuum assembly and method

According to various aspects of the disclosure, a valve assembly for a vacuum chamber housing may have: a valve housing, which has a substrate transfer gap; a valve flap, which is mounted so as to be rotatable about an axis of rotation, thus enabling said flap to be rotated into a first position and into a second position, wherein the axis of rotation is arranged in the substrate transfer gap, and wherein the substrate transfer gap is extended longitudinally along the axis of rotation; wherein the valve flap closes the substrate transfer gap in the first position and is arranged adjacent to the substrate transfer gap in the second position.
